About Susan A. Brooks

Susan A. Brooks is a scholar working on Immunology and Allergy, Biotechnology and Immunology, having authored 88 papers that have together received 2.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(40 papers), Galectins and Cancer Biology (18 papers) and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(17 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cancer Research (511 citations), Immunology and Allergy (200 citations) and Immunology (610 citations). Susan A. Brooks has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Germany and United States. Frequent co-authors include Debbie Hall, Anthony J. Leathem, Ryan Pink, Priya Samuel, Udo Schumacher, Inge Bernstein, David Raul Francisco Carter, Hannah J. Lomax-Browne, Miriam Dwek and Daniel P. Caley. Their work appears in journals such as The Lancet, Journal of Clinical Oncology and Analytical Biochemistry.
